Keith Kohl | Jul 11, 2024 Is it good to invest in natural gas? Anyone with a dime invested in energy stocks over the past few years has asked themself this question at some point or another. Back in 2022, natural gas catapulted into the energy spotlight after Russian tanks started rolling into Ukraine. We watched as spot prices at the Henry Hub soared to nearly $9 per million British thermal units (MMBtu) â almost tripling year-over-year! The winners back then were clear, too. Shares of major natural gas producers like EQT Corp. (NYSE: [EQT]() surged more than 122% between February and August of 2022. It turns out that Putin was serious about cutting natural gas exports to Europe, which led EU members to heavily rely on U.S. LNG to heat, cool, and power their homes during the winter; remember, roughly 40% of Europeâs gas demand is used by the residential sector. A lot of investors were left on the sidelines for that run and for good reason. The flood of supply that had poured into the U.S. after the shale boom erupted, caused prices to fall precipitously. Thereâs a few catalysts to consider there. For starters, natural gas producers in the U.S. have been curtailing production this year in order to stabilize prices, which means theyâre drilling less. Couple this lower output with strong demand, and weâre already seeing a dent in natural gas inventories. The EIA reported that U.S. gas storage inventories were 19% above the five-year average; keep in mind that inventories were 39% above the five-year average at the end of the withdrawal season at the end of March. Then again, the EIA is also forecasting that flat production and a boost in summer demand, as well as stronger LNG exports, will lead to natural gas prices rising 41% to $3.30 per MMBtu.
